Akr Corporindo Tbk (AKRA) - Total Assets

Latest as of December 2025: Rp36.56 Trillion IDR ≈ $2.14 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Akr Corporindo Tbk (AKRA) holds total assets worth Rp36.56 Trillion IDR (≈ $2.14 Billion USD) as of December 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. PT AKR Corporindo Tbk, a logistics and supply chain company, engages in distribution and trading of petroleum and basic chemical products in Indonesia. It operates through four segments: Trading and Distribution, Logistics Services, Manufacturing, and Industrial Estate and related utility services.
